How they compare
Bhutan currently reports 88,312 against 71,785 in Cyprus, a difference of 16,527.
That makes Bhutan's figure about 1.2 times Cyprus's.
Across all 26 years both countries report, Bhutan has been ahead every year.
Bhutan ranks 160th and Cyprus ranks 162nd of 191 countries.
Bhutan has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bhutan | Cyprus |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 90,024 | 75,074 | 14,950 | Bhutan |
| 2000s | 105,525 | 79,019 | 26,505 | Bhutan |
| 2010s | 94,071 | 74,957 | 19,114 | Bhutan |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
